Over the weekend, HTC has started rolling out the Android 4.4.3 KitKat update for the One M8 units available in India. The update brings several enhancements to the user interface and performance with the most highlighted one being the support for 4G LTE networks. Also, it adds some bug fixes to the Open SSL vulnerabilities as well.
According to XDA Developers, a Mumbai based user with the username ‘n1234d’ has posted a screenshot of the changelog after the Android 4.4.3 KitKat update on HTC One M8. According to this changelog, the update not only brings the aforementioned changes, but improvements to the native Gallery, Camera and HTC Sync Manager along with some tweaks to the power usage history in the Settings app.
Going by the image, there are enhancements for wireless networks including Bluetooth, Wi-Fi and mobile networks along with improvements to the Sense UI, It is also claimed that the update will bring about bug fixes to the LED notification light and BoomSound speaker.
The Android 4.4.3 KitKat update measures 658 MB and it is rolled out as an OTA update. Users of the HTC One M8 can check for the update manually by going to Settings -> About Phone -> Software Update.
